    Hugo's not the best goalkeeper in the world but he's in the top 20 and at his best, he's in the top 10. however, he has clearly identifiable issues:
    1. I cringe every time we pass around at the back. His distribution is shocking;
    2. He can be iffy on crosses. He's not the tallest or the biggest, which make him fast and agile but he's no Big Pat or Ray Clemence;
    3. The near post is less of an issue compared to 2 or 3 years ago but it's still an issue.
    We couldn't afford to buy a goalkeeper who is currently performing better than Hugo every week,, we'd need to buy someone that would become that good, if we could find such a player and beat all the other buyers to his signature. Not easy.

    Also, who's going to offer us the kind of money that would tempt us to sell and him to move, given that he has those issues. Pretty much every top team wants a 'keeper who passes like an outfield player. I think that our futures are currently joined and that's a lot better than Toby, right now.
